What Is an eSIM and How Does It Work?

An eSIM (embedded SIM) is a digital SIM card built directly into your smartphone, tablet, or smartwatch. Instead of inserting a plastic SIM card, you download a mobile data profile from a carrier or eSIM app. The profile installs digitally, allowing your device to connect to local carrier networks.

Here’s how it typically works:

  • Step 1: Download an eSIM app from a provider.
  • Step 2: Choose a country, region, or global data plan.
  • Step 3: Purchase and install the eSIM profile.
  • Step 4: Activate it when you arrive at your destination.

Most modern smartphones, including recent iPhone, Google Pixel, and Samsung Galaxy models, support eSIM technology. In many cases, you can even use both your home SIM and travel eSIM at the same time.

Why eSIM Apps Are Changing Travel Connectivity

Traditional roaming services are often expensive and unpredictable. Physical prepaid SIM cards require locating a store, presenting identification in some countries, and manually swapping cards. eSIM apps eliminate these pain points.

Key advantages of eSIM apps include:

  • Instant activation: No waiting in lines or visiting kiosks.
  • No physical SIM swapping: Keep your primary number active.
  • Transparent pricing: See rates upfront before purchasing.
  • Multiple plans stored at once: Ideal for multi-country trips.
  • Remote management: Top up or switch plans from anywhere.

For business travelers especially, the ability to land in a foreign country and instantly connect to high-speed data is invaluable. It ensures seamless access to email, maps, ride-sharing apps, and communication platforms.

Popular eSIM Apps for Global Travel

Several companies now specialize in international eSIM services. Each offers unique pricing models, coverage areas, and features. Below is a look at some of the most widely used eSIM apps for travel connectivity.

1. Airalo

Airalo is one of the largest eSIM marketplaces, offering country-specific, regional, and global plans. It partners with local carriers worldwide and is known for competitive pricing.

2. Holafly

Holafly focuses on unlimited data plans in many destinations. It is popular among heavy data users who stream, attend video meetings, or rely on continuous navigation.

3. Nomad

Nomad offers flexible plans in over 100 countries and provides straightforward pricing with occasional promotions.

4. GigSky

GigSky targets both consumers and enterprise customers, providing global coverage and cruise or offshore connectivity options.

5. Ubigi

Ubigi supports smartphones, tablets, and even connected laptops and cars. It also provides long-term and recurring plans for frequent travelers.

Cost Benefits Compared to Roaming

International roaming through your home carrier can cost anywhere from $5 to $15 per day or more. In contrast, many eSIM apps offer:

  • 1GB for under $5 in certain countries
  • 10GB regional bundles at discounted rates
  • Unlimited plans for a fixed flat fee

This pricing flexibility makes eSIM apps especially attractive for longer trips or multi-country travel. Instead of paying for daily roaming passes, you can select exactly the amount of data you need.

Regional and Global Data Plans Explained

eSIM apps typically offer three types of plans:

  • Single-country plans: Best for travelers staying in one destination.
  • Regional plans: Cover multiple countries, such as Europe or Southeast Asia.
  • Global plans: Provide connectivity across dozens of countries under one package.

Regional plans are especially useful for backpackers or business travelers visiting multiple countries in a short period. You won’t need to purchase separate plans for each border crossing.

Important Considerations Before Choosing an eSIM App

While eSIM apps offer convenience, there are a few factors to evaluate:

  • Device compatibility: Confirm your phone supports eSIM technology.
  • Data speed: Check whether the plan offers 4G, LTE, or 5G coverage.
  • Hotspot support: Some unlimited plans restrict tethering.
  • Validity period: Ensure the plan duration matches your trip length.
  • Customer support: 24/7 chat support can be critical if issues arise abroad.

Also consider whether you need voice and SMS capabilities. Many eSIM travel apps focus primarily on data-only plans, though app-based messaging services usually make this a minor concern.

Security and Privacy Benefits

Using public Wi-Fi networks in airports and hotels exposes travelers to potential security risks. With a personal mobile data connection via eSIM, you reduce the likelihood of cyber threats such as:

  • Data interception
  • Man-in-the-middle attacks
  • Malicious hotspots

A secure mobile connection is especially important for professionals accessing company systems or handling sensitive financial information.

The Future of Travel Connectivity

The adoption of eSIM technology continues to grow rapidly. Many smartphone manufacturers are moving toward eSIM-only devices, eliminating physical SIM trays entirely. Airlines, travel platforms, and even financial apps are beginning to integrate eSIM offers directly into their booking processes.

In the near future, travelers may purchase mobile data automatically when booking a flight — activating the plan as soon as the plane lands. As 5G networks expand globally, eSIM apps will likely offer even faster speeds and more flexible packages.
